Benefits of Metal Siding
Metal siding presents a range of benefits that make it a preferred choice for homeowners:
- Durability: Metal siding is highly resistant to harsh weather conditions, pests, and rot, ensuring your home maintains its structural integrity over the years.
- Low Maintenance: One of the standout features of metal siding is its minimal upkeep. Unlike wood siding, it does not require frequent painting or sealing.
- Energy Efficiency: Metal siding, when installed with proper insulation, can enhance your home's energy efficiency, helping to lower heating and cooling costs.
- Aesthetic Variety: Available in various colors, finishes, and styles, metal siding can easily complement different architectural designs, from modern to traditional.
The Metal Siding Replacement Process
The process of replacing old siding with metal can seem daunting, but with an experienced contractor, it can be smooth and manageable. Here’s what you can typically expect:
- Consultation and Assessment: Initially, a consultation will allow the contractor to assess your current siding and discuss your specific needs and preferences.
- Material Selection: Next, you will select the type of metal siding that best suits your style and budget. Common options include aluminum, steel, and zinc.
- Preparation: The installation area will be prepared by removing the old siding and making any necessary repairs to the underlying structure.
- Installation: The new metal siding will be installed according to manufacturer guidelines, ensuring proper sealing and insulation.
- Final Inspection: After installation, a final walk-through will be conducted to ensure everything has been completed to your satisfaction.

Common Challenges and Customer Concerns
Homeowners often have legitimate concerns when replacing siding. Among them are the costs, potential disruptions during installation, and the longevity of materials. It is essential to address these head-on:
- Cost: While the initial investment in metal siding can be higher than wood or vinyl, its long-term durability makes it a wise financial choice.
- Disruptions: The replacement process can be intrusive, but a professional team will work efficiently to minimize inconvenience and maintain clean workspaces.
- Longevity: When properly maintained, metal siding can last for decades, providing excellent value for your investment.
